Job description

• Take full responsibility for conducting all necessary field surveys, from initial site reconnaissance and boundary identification to final as-built documentation.

• Establish and maintain control points and site benchmarks, ensuring their integrity throughout the construction process.

• Lead the execution of topographic and as-built surveys to capture essential data.

• Take charge of site layout by performing accurate setting out and marking of all structural and infrastructural elements such as roads, buildings, utilities, and earthworks.

• Leadership role in managing and guiding the surveying team, including junior surveyors and chainmen.

• Act as the primary liaison between the survey team and project engineers, contractors, and stakeholders.

• Oversee the collection, processing, and interpretation of survey data using tools like total stations (Sokkia, Leica), and AutoCAD. Prepare and present comprehensive survey reports that inform key project decisions.

• Take ownership of identifying and resolving on-site issues, such as site discrepancies, inaccuracies in setting out, or conflicts between design plans and site conditions.

• Implement strict quality control protocols to ensure the accuracy, reliability, and legal compliance of all surveying tasks.
